The world of application and its related services are migrating more towards cloud, because of availability, Elasticity, Manageability etc. While moving the entire stack we need to be very cautious while migrating the database part.
Migration of DB servers is not a simple lift and shift operation, Rather it would require a proper planning and more cautious in maintaining data consistency with existing DB server and cloud server by means of native replication or by using any third party tools.
The best way to migrate the existing MySQL database to RDS, in my opinion, is by using “logical backup“. Some of the logical backup tools as below,
